The demand for PCB (Printed Circuit Board) design services in the market has been steadily increasing due to several factors:
Electronics Industry Growth: The proliferation of electronics in various sectors such as consumer electronics, automotive, aerospace, healthcare, and IoT has led to an increased demand for PCBs.
Miniaturization: As electronic devices become smaller and more compact, the need for intricate PCB designs to accommodate complex circuitry within limited space has risen.
Technology Advancements: Advancements in technology, such as the Internet of Things (IoT), 5G connectivity, and wearable devices, require innovative PCB designs to support their functionalities.
Rapid Prototyping: The trend towards rapid prototyping and shortening product development cycles necessitates efficient PCB design services to quickly iterate and test new designs.
Customization: Industries increasingly require customized PCBs tailored to their specific needs, which drives demand for PCB design services capable of delivering bespoke solutions.
Outsourcing Trends: Many companies prefer to outsource their PCB design requirements to specialized service providers to leverage expertise, reduce costs, and accelerate time-to-market.
Green Initiatives: There's a growing emphasis on environmentally friendly PCB designs, leading to demand for designers who can develop energy-efficient and recyclable PCBs.

PCB Design Course Content is given below in brief:
Schematic Design:
Basic Electronics theory.
Basics of Circuit designing.
Schematic design preparation.
Schematic part editing and creation.
Net list and Net class creation.
Bill Of Material generation (BOM).
Electrical Rule Checking.
Footprint Creation:
Through hole footprint creation.
Surface Mount Device footprint creation.
BGA/PGA footprint creation.
Board Designing:
Board size and shape creation.
Component placements.
PCB Routing.
Plane creation.
Design rule checking.
Gerber generation.
